Output 52f8f69cacd94c5576fcd4e2ffddebaa76ee0a6a77b8031b69dd028b58cf4249:0

value
6087095
script pubkey
OP_0 OP_PUSHBYTES_20 ddae92432798d315bf69ee2310aa38787ee6c7a5
address
bc1qmkhfyse8nrf3t0mfac33p23c0plwd3a96vxyzy
transaction
52f8f69cacd94c5576fcd4e2ffddebaa76ee0a6a77b8031b69dd028b58cf4249
confirmations
71817
spent
true